From: Peter Hutterer <peter.hutterer@who-t.net>
|
|
Date: Tue, 27 Mar 2012 12:18:46 +1000
|
|
Subject: [PATCH] Allow relative scroll valuators on absolute devices
|
|
|
|
Special-case RHEL_WHEEL, RHEL_HWHEEL and REL_DIAL to add scroll valuators
|
|
for those axes on top of the absolute axes.
|
|
|
|
https://bugzilla.redhat.com/show_bug.cgi?id=805902
